Community & Conduct

I want to make something clear regarding the way discussions are conducted in my repositories.

I am completely open to constructive criticism, technical feedback, bug reports, alternative implementations, and suggestions for improvement. You are absolutely welcome to disagree with my decisions or point out problems in my code.

What I do not accept, however, is personal or disrespectful commentary about me or other contributors.

Criticizing the software is perfectly fine. Attacking, belittling, or making dismissive assumptions about the person behind the software is not.

There is a real person behind every GitHub account, and you often don't know what someone may be dealing with outside of their work on a project. In my own case, there have been periods where personal and health circumstances have made it difficult for me to maintain my projects as actively as I would like. That should never be used as a reason to make personal judgments about me or my abilities.

I also use AI as a development tool. I am not ashamed of that, nor do I believe that using AI makes someone's work or contribution inherently less legitimate. Reasonable discussion about AI-assisted development is welcome; personal attacks or assumptions about someone's competence because they use AI are not.

I want my repositories to be places where people can collaborate, learn, contribute and have technical discussions without turning disagreements into personal attacks.

Constructive criticism is welcome. Personal attacks are not.

If someone repeatedly chooses to communicate in a disrespectful or personally insulting manner, I will not engage in an argument about it. I will simply block the account and, where appropriate, remove or report the offending content.

This isn't intended to discourage criticism or disagreement. Quite the opposite — I want people to tell me when something is wrong. I simply expect that criticism to remain focused on the project and the work, rather than becoming criticism of the person.

Please keep discussions respectful.
